Copied from my BBB complaint against this company:

On 05/09/2009 I followed a link to the website of Seattle Coffee Direct to purchase a promotional item. Per the promotion, I was to have received 2 lbs of coffee, 2 coffee mugs and 2 travel mugs. The order was placed using a Visa Check Card attached to my bank account.

On 5/11/09, a debit was processed against my account for $25.00 from "Metro Coffee". This was not the agreed upon amount for these items.

Additionally, on 5/11/09 an unauthorized charge from "Metro Coffee" was initiated for $38.95 and processed on 5/13/09. Once the fraudulent charge was discovered, a Federal Regulation E dispute was filed with my bank on 5/20/2009 for the $38.95 charge. On 6/3/09 the dispute was settled with my bank in my favor resulting in a credit of $38.95.

In addition, I called "Seattle Direct Coffee" and disputed the charge with them. I was told that the $38.95 was the monthly charge for the coffee club I had joined and that they could not refund the monies until the product had been returned. I received the coffee in the mail several days later and sent it back to them. At that time, they "canceled" the membership that I had not authorized and stated they would reverse the charge once the coffee was returned. The coffee was returned with delivery confirmation and was delivered back to the company on 5/20/09.

The initial charge was supposed to have been $5.00. In reading the terms of service when I paid for it, there was no language that indicated that I was signing up for a "monthly coffee club".

I would like a refund of, at minimum, $26.50. This is the difference between the $5.00 promotional price touted by the company and the $25.00 price actually charged by the company AND the cost to return the coffee that I did not order to the company.

Because my Federal Regulation E dispute has already been settled for the $38.95 charge and is now in the hands of the banking industry, I feel that that charge has been settled.
